History

Tucked under the slopes of the Papegaaiberg, on the outskirts of the historic old town of Stellenbosch, lies a famous landmark in the winelands. This is Die Bergkelder. Founded in 1967, this famous “cellar in the mountain” was the first of its kind in South Africa and is today home to some of the Cape’s finest wines.

 

Die Bergkelder has distinguished itself by continually setting trends in the wine business. In the 1970s, it played a pivotal role in South African producing world class wines, by persuading grape-growers to introduce the classic noble varieties to their vineyards. Among these varieties are Chardonnay, Sauvignon Blanc,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c and Merlot. In 1979, it took the lead by introducing maturation of quality wine in small casks of new French oak. In 1998, Die Bergkelder launched its unique range of Fleur du Cap unfiltered wines, with the intention of retaining the natural flavours and varietal character of the grapes, with the least amount of human interference.

Winemaking

Fleur du Cap wines undoubtedly live up to the description found on the bottles, “Wines inspired by nature”. The journey all begins with the best quality grapes, meticulously selected from a collection of leading vineyards around the Cape.

 

On the vine, these grapes are shaped by the temperate climate of the Cape Coastal region. Once in the hands of our passionate winemakers, the special qualities of the grapes are expertly captured. The result is a range of superbly balanced wines that abound with fruit and flavour, vintage after vintage. The Fleur du Cap wines are handcrafted by dedicated and renowned winemakers, Pieter Badenhorst and Wim Truter under the guidance of cellar master, Andrea Freeborough.
